With oversize valves (might add some weight to the valve, giving it more inertia) and stage 2 cams (the high lift) the stock springs might not be enough. Now I have herd that people don't have a problem revving to 8k rpm with stage 2 cams, yes it loses HP but I would feel a lot better with stiffer springs. That said, I have oversized valves and stage 2 cams in my engine, and I will be running stock springs:cool:

ya may want to see if there are any beehive style springs available. they control valve bounce better, so you can go with lighter springs. the big question is, are there any that would fit the SHO?

+1 mm valves here : http://www.rcmautomotive.com/id16.html

You cant go any higher then that anyway , not enough space in the combustion chamber.

Stiffer springs ,FPS http://www.fordspecialists.com/ has these , But at 8k RPM theres no valve floating with stock springs. Unless you want to go higher.
